Content DescriptionReturn to Top
This collection consists of photocopied biographical material on Dr. James Hawthorne collected by his descendent James H. Beck, as well as materials on Dr. Simeon Josephi and his family, including a VHS-taped interview with his descendent George Durham.
Biographical NoteReturn to Top
Dr. James Hawthorne (1819-1881) founded the Oregon Hospital for the Insane in 1862; his protégé, Dr. Simeon Edward Josephi (1849-1935) carried on his work after he died. Dr. Josephi originally came west from New York City to work as Dr. Hawthorne's bookkeeper. After eight years on the business side of the hospital, he was inspired to also become a physician. He went on to become a prominent doctor, a two-term state senator, and the first dean of the University of Oregon Medical School (predecessor to OHSU).
